Transaction 515344eef6445b23e7414e8da8ca61223f01000873088f5b9776568360e6711f
1 Input
1 Output
-
515344eef6445b23e7414e8da8ca61223f01000873088f5b9776568360e6711f:0
- value
- 1637838
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2960b7840ad38f43910a65b3a6efdcb654c1415
- address
- bc1q62tqk7zq45u0gwgs5edn5mhaedj5c9q4vdnk6l